Buying Factors You Shouldn’t Ignore
- Climate Strategy: Specify polymer formulas and powder coats for freeze-thaw and UV. In Wyoming, that’s a baseline, not an upgrade. Rugged stadium seating depends on chemistry and bolts—not luck.
- Loads and Structure: Confirm live, snow, and wind in the design narrative and submittals. Proper PSF values and bracing secure bleachers and chair platforms when gusts race across the plains.
- Sightlines First: Fans forgive weather; they won’t forgive blocked views. Maintain C-values through correct rise, tread, and aisle geometry. Stadium seating is only as good as the view it delivers on a busy night.
- Maintenance: Choose finishes that pressure-wash clean, hardware that resists corrosion, and components with replaceable parts. That lowers lifetime cost.
- Accessibility: Distribute ADA seating throughout the bowl with companion positions. Make it easy to reach, easy to evacuate, and easy to enjoy.
- Total Cost of Ownership: The cheapest bid often costs more in year five. Premium coatings, stainless fasteners, and thoughtful details save labor season after season.

Quick Glossary
- C-Value: A visibility metric protecting the view over the person in front.
- Rise/Tread: Step geometry affecting comfort and egress.
- Beam-Mount/Floor-Mount: Two ways seats attach to structure.
- ICC-300/IBC/ADA: Codes for safety and access in stadium seating.
- PSF: Pounds per square foot; drives structural design.
- Wind Uplift: Forces seeking to lift components during gusts common on the plains.
- Cold-Crack/UV: Material resistance to freezing temps and sunlight.
- Telescopic: Fold-away platforms for multi-use spaces.
